Abstract

The invention belongs to paint-color matching technical fields, disclose a kind of paint Automatic color matching device, including rack, and it is installed on the paint kettle in rack, paint cylinder and color matching mechanism, it is connected between color matching mechanism and the paint kettle and send Qi Guandao, and color matching mechanism includes color matching tank and send paint component, discharge chamber and negative suction feed cavity are wherein successively offered in color matching tank from the bottom to top, and discharge chamber and negative inhale are connected with conduction pipe between feed cavity, the middle position at discharge bottom of chamber end is provided with drainage conduit, and drainage conduit and paint cylinder cooperate, the negative inspiration material is intracavitary to be equipped with piston plate and sealing plate, and piston plate is located at the lower section of sealing plate;With a negative cooperation inhaled between structure and multiple control valves in the present invention, charging while realizing a variety of different colours paint, to complete color matching operation, opposite with for traditional paint feeding mechanism, structure of the invention is simpler and energy consumption is lower.

Background technique
Paint-color matching, which refers to, carries out a certain proportion of mixing for the paint of a variety of different colours, to obtain the new color of one kind Paint does not have to user to the individual requirement of color of paint to meet;
It is operated for paint-color matching, in CN201820423003.X patent, discloses a kind of matching automatically for paint Color device with effective automatic operation realized when painting precisely color matching, and has preferable stability in use and safety;
But according to the structure disclosed in above-mentioned patent it is found that the device is directed to each primary colors in actual use Paint be both needed to one group of paint feeding mechanism of setting, thus can then make the structure of whole device of matching colors excessively complicated and each Group paint feeding mechanism includes a rotating electric machine as driving part, then can make the Energy in use of whole device of matching colors again It is larger;
Although in addition, be provided with the clamping device of paint cylinder in the device, must cooperation accommodation groove carry out using and painting Cylinder, using the mode picked and placed up and down, after completing paint-color matching, paints to have been loaded in cylinder and match when being placed in accommodation groove Good paint then will lead to the pick-and-place difficulty up and down of paint cylinder so that the weight of paint cylinder itself is greatly improved at this time Increase.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.It is based on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ts every other Embodiment shall fall within the protection scope of the present invention.
It please refers to shown in Fig. 1-Fig. 3, the invention provides the following technical scheme: a kind of paint Automatic color matching device, including machine Frame 1 and the paint kettle 2 being installed in rack 1, paint cylinder 3 and color matching mechanism 4, color matching mechanism 4 are located at the top of paint cylinder 3, And be connected between color matching mechanism 4 and paint kettle 2 and give Qi Guandao 21, it send and electromagnetic flow control valve is installed on Qi Guandao 21 22, it send and is also equipped with check (non-return) valve 23 on Qi Guandao 21, color matching mechanism 4 includes color matching tank 41 and send paint component 42, wherein tank of matching colors Discharge chamber 411 and negative suction feed cavity 412 are successively offered in 41 from the bottom to top, and between discharge chamber 411 and negative suction feed cavity 412 It is connected with conduction pipe 413, the middle position of 411 bottom end of discharge chamber is provided with drainage conduit, and drainage conduit and paint cylinder 3 cooperate, Negative inhale in feed cavity 412 is equipped with piston plate 414 and sealing plate 415, and piston plate 414 is located at the lower section of sealing plate 415;Specifically 414 top surface of piston plate be symmetrical arranged two slopes, and the combination of two slopes constitutes splayed configuration structures;
Sending paint component 42 includes mounting rack 421 and the first electric putter 422, and wherein mounting rack 421 is welded in color matching tank 41 Top, middle position of first electric putter 422 through mounting rack 421, and the movable end and piston plate of the first electric putter 422 414 top connection.
In above structure, negative feed cavity 412, piston plate 414 and the first electric putter 422 of inhaling cooperatively forms a negative suction structure, And realize that the synchronous of a variety of paint feeds by negative suction effect, practical process is as follows: the primary colors according to required for paint-color matching Paint opens electromagnetic flow control valve 22 corresponding to corresponding paint kettle 2, so that this send Qi Guandao 21 to be rendered as on state, Four paint kettles 2 are only shown in specific Fig. 1 and send Qi Guandao 21, but are not limited only to four;
Then start the first electric putter 422, the first electric putter 422 pushes piston plate 414 to move down, so that negative inhale feed cavity Negative pressure state is formed in 412, and negative suction feed cavity 412 is connected with the formation of Qi Guandao 21 is sent, thus by sending Qi Guandao 21 to inhale Enter the primary colors paint in each paint kettle 2, is sent in Qi Guandao 21 by the detection correspondence of electromagnetic flow control valve 22 in the process The amount of paint of importing then closes electromagnetic flow control valve 22 after completing quantitative import, to guarantee the accuracy of color matching dosage;
As piston plate 414 moves down, the paint of importing gradually increases, and piston plate 414 can move closer to conduction pipe 413 End suitable for reading, until form the position location of piston plate 414 in Fig. 3, the end suitable for reading of conduction pipe 413, which is exposed to, at this time negative inhales feed cavity In 412, so that negative inhale feed cavity 412 and the formation conducting of discharge chamber 411, and the negative paint inhaled in feed cavity 412 then passes through conducting Pipe 413 enters in discharge chamber 411, is then discharged into paint cylinder 3 by drainage conduit, and the Automatic color matching of assorted paint is completed with this.
It please refers to shown in Fig. 1 and Fig. 4, further, rack 1 includes bottom plate 11, side plate 12 and laminate 13,2 He of paint kettle Paint cylinder 3 is placed on bottom plate 11, and color matching mechanism 4 is installed on laminate 13;
It is located at the position of 3 lower section of paint cylinder on bottom plate 11 and offers sliding slot 111, and the internal slide connection of sliding slot 111 There is slide plate 112,112 top of slide plate is supported by parcel shelf 113 by elastomeric element, and elastomeric element is rubber spring, and is painted Cylinder 3 is placed on parcel shelf 113.
Specifically, paint cylinder 3 need to be placed in the lower section of color matching mechanism 4, place step such as before starting single unit system Under: parcel shelf 113 is pulled, the pull-out of parcel shelf 113 is realized using the sliding between sliding slot 111 and slide plate 112, so that parcel shelf 113 are located at the side of color matching mechanism 4;Then it takes a paint cylinder 3 to be placed in parcel shelf 113, pushes back parcel shelf 113 and drive paint cylinder 3 are positioned at the underface of color matching mechanism 4, that is, complete the placement of paint cylinder 3.
It please refers to shown in Fig. 4, further, boss is equipped on the two sidewalls of sliding slot 111, and boss extends to slide plate 112 in the gap of parcel shelf 113, and the bottom end and boss top of parcel shelf 113 are respectively equipped with limiting slot 114 and limiting tooth 115, And limiting slot 114 and limiting tooth 115 are intermeshed;
Refering to Figure 1, the bottom end of laminate 13 is embedded with the second electric putter 14, and the bottom end welding of the second electric putter 14 There is pressing plate 15, pressing plate 15 is located at 3 top of paint cylinder, and is formed to push to paint cylinder 3 and be fixed, and wherein pressing plate 15 is ring structure, Guarantee that drainage conduit can effectively import paint in paint cylinder 3 with this;
In above structure, the second electric putter 14 cooperates with pressing plate 15, realizes the compression from top to bottom to paint cylinder 3, thus Make to paint the thrust that cylinder 3 applies pushing to parcel shelf 113, elastomeric element is squeezed with this, and make the bottom end of parcel shelf 113 close Boss, and then form limiting slot 114 with limiting tooth 115 and engage, realize that the positioning of parcel shelf 113 and paint cylinder 3 is solid with this It is fixed;
The second electric putter 14 and pressing plate 15 are recycled after completing paint-color matching, supports parcel shelf using elastomeric element at this time 113, so that limiting slot 114 is separated with limiting tooth 115, to guarantee that global facility still has sliding effect, then pull out glove Plate 113, so that the paint cylinder 3 for having been loaded with paint is exported, paint cylinder 3 is then removed from parcel shelf 113 can be completed taking-up Operation;
To sum up, sliding slot 111, slide plate 112 and parcel shelf 113 combine the containing structure for forming transverse shifting, to realize paint The lateral of cylinder 3 picks and places, and operation difficulty is lower and firmly smaller.
It please refers to shown in Fig. 5, specifically, the top of parcel shelf 113 offers cone tank, and is formed and painted by cone tank The guide-localization of cylinder 3.
When actually placing paint cylinder 3, paint 3 bottom end of cylinder is contacted with the formation of the cone tank on 113 top of parcel shelf, at this time tiltedly To the conical surface then to paint cylinder 3 have certain guiding role, enable paint 3 effective position of cylinder in the middle position of cone tank It is accurate corresponding to guarantee that paint cylinder 3 is formed with parcel shelf 113 for place, and whether the size for no matter painting cylinder 3 changes, and can have There is the effect of above-mentioned guide-localization.
It please refers to shown in Fig. 2-Fig. 3, it is worth noting that, the position of 422 two sides of the first electric putter is located on mounting rack 421 Place, which is run through, third electric putter 423, and the bottom end of two third electric putters 423 forms with sealing plate 415 and connects;
Specifically, driven by third electric putter 423, sealing plate 415 is pushed to move down, at this time sealing plate 415 Edge carries out stripping operation to color matching 41 inner wall of tank, so that it is disposed of the paint adhered on color matching 41 inner wall of tank, so that this Arranging device proposed in invention also has good cleaning effect, avoids the problem that paint mixing occurs in front and back toning.
Preferably, the bottom end of sealing plate 415 is symmetrical arranged there are two slope surface, and two slope surfaces combine to form inverse Ba type knot Structure;
Match specifically, slope surface set by 415 bottom surface of sealing plate is just formed with slope set by 414 top surface of piston plate It closes, guarantees that sealing plate 415 moves down to be formed with piston plate 414 with this and cooperate, to guarantee when sealing plate 415 is mobile to color matching tank The integrality that the paint adhered on 41 inner walls strikes off.
Preferably, spring 424 is welded between mounting rack 421 and sealing plate 415, and spring 424 is in is stretched always State, for realizing effective sealing of sealing plate 415;
Specifically, as shown in Fig. 2, the spring 424 of tensional state generates upward rebound pulling force to sealing plate 415, thus It is sticked in sealing plate 415 closely at the tank mouth of color matching tank 41, to guarantee the effectively negative leakproofness inhaled in feed cavity 412.
